I live in Phoenix, AZ. As a bird watcher, I have observed some of the Northern Mockingbirds in my area over the years. They seem to disappear from Phoenix during the hottest months (over 100F+). I believe they must migrate north to where it is cooler between May and late September. (I have no specific evidence of where they go though so it’s just a guess.) One particular individual bird arrived back to his tree outside my office building entrance this week. I arrived to work Oct 1 to hear his voice singing out his distinctive mockingbird song. Sure enough there he was at the top of his favorite tree.
